The Miami Heat would defeat the New York Knicks on Friday evening by a score of 129-115. Bam Adebayo would lead the Heat with 20 points and 8 rebounds. This game would mark the return of Goran Dragic, who would come off the Heat bench with 18 points and 8 assists. Duncan Robinson would contribute 18 points on 6 three pointers, and Kendrick Nunn would add 15 points and 3 assists. Derrick Jones Jr would once again look impressive with 14 points and 7 rebounds, and Tyler Herro would add 12 points. Kelly Olynk would also shine for the well-balanced Heat, as he would add 10 points and 10 rebounds off the Heat bench. The struggling Knicks were led by Bobby Portis, who would score 30 points along with 8 rebounds and 3 steals. Marcus Morris Sr would add 15 points and Mitchell Robinson would have 18 points for the Knicks, also Julius Randle would score 13 points along with 8 rebounds. The Heat will play the 2nd game of this 4 game home stand against the Utah Jazz on Monday night 12/23.
